Keamanan Siber dan Kerentanan Perangkat Lunak
Keamanan siber adalah topik yang semakin penting dalam dunia digital saat ini. Dalam artikel ini, kita akan menjelajahi konsep keamanan siber dan mengapa kerentanan perangkat lunak menjadi salah satu aspek terpenting dalam menjaga keamanan online.
Keamanan Siber: Apa Itu dan Mengapa Penting?
Keamanan siber merujuk pada praktik dan teknologi yang dirancang untuk melindungi sistem komputer, jaringan, dan data dari serangan, pencurian, atau kerusakan. Ini mencakup berbagai aspek seperti enkripsi data, pemantauan lalu lintas internet, dan tindakan pencegahan yang bertujuan untuk menjaga integritas dan kerahasiaan informasi.
Keamanan siber sangat penting karena:
- Melindungi Data Sensitif: Data pribadi dan bisnis yang disimpan dalam sistem komputer harus dilindungi dari akses yang tidak sah.
- Mencegah Serangan Malware: Keamanan siber membantu dalam mencegah serangan perangkat lunak berbahaya seperti virus dan ransomware.
- Menjaga Keberlanjutan Bisnis: Serangan siber dapat mengganggu operasi bisnis, mengakibatkan kerugian finansial yang besar.
- Mencegah Pencurian Identitas: Identitas individu dapat dicuri dalam serangan siber, yang dapat memiliki konsekuensi serius.
Kerentanan Perangkat Lunak: Apa Itu dan Mengapa Dikhawatirkan?
Kerentanan perangkat lunak adalah celah atau kelemahan dalam perangkat lunak yang dapat dimanfaatkan oleh penyerang untuk mengakses sistem atau data yang tidak seharusnya mereka akses. Kerentanan perangkat lunak dapat terjadi dalam berbagai jenis perangkat lunak, termasuk sistem operasi, aplikasi, dan bahkan perangkat keras.
Mengapa kerentanan perangkat lunak menjadi masalah serius dalam keamanan siber?
- Eksploitasi Potensial: Penyerang dapat menggunakan kerentanan perangkat lunak untuk meretas sistem, mencuri data, atau merusak perangkat lunak yang terinfeksi.
- Peningkatan Serangan: Penemuan kerentanan perangkat lunak dapat mengarah pada peningkatan serangan siber.
- Peretasan Terhadap Perusahaan Besar: Kasus-kasus terkenal seperti serangan terhadap perusahaan besar sering kali melibatkan eksploitasi kerentanan perangkat lunak.
Contoh Kerentanan Perangkat Lunak Terkenal
Untuk memberikan gambaran lebih jelas tentang kerentanan perangkat lunak, berikut beberapa contoh terkenal:
1. Heartbleed (CVE-2014-0160)
Kerentanan Heartbleed adalah kelemahan dalam perpustakaan enkripsi OpenSSL yang digunakan secara luas. Ini memungkinkan penyerang untuk mencuri data sensitif seperti kunci enkripsi dan kata sandi dari server yang rentan.
2. WannaCry Ransomware
WannaCry adalah serangan ransomware yang menyebar dengan cepat pada tahun 2017. Serangan ini memanfaatkan kerentanan perangkat lunak Windows yang tidak diperbarui untuk mengenkripsi data pengguna dan menuntut pembayaran tebusan.
3. Shellshock (CVE-2014-6271)
Shellshock adalah kerentanan dalam shell bash yang digunakan pada sebagian besar sistem Unix. Ini memungkinkan penyerang untuk menjalankan perintah shell secara tidak sah di sistem yang terpengaruh.
Statistik tentang Kerentanan Perangkat Lunak
Untuk menggambarkan besarnya masalah kerentanan perangkat lunak, berikut beberapa statistik yang relevan:
- Pada tahun 2022, ada lebih dari 21.000 kerentanan perangkat lunak yang dilaporkan, dengan sebagian besar berpotensi berdampak serius (National Vulnerability Database).
- 70% serangan siber yang berhasil memanfaatkan kerentanan perangkat lunak yang ada (Verizon’s Data Breach Investigations Report 2022).
- Lebih dari 90% serangan phishing dimulai dengan email berbahaya yang mengandung kode berbahaya yang mengeksploitasi kerentanan perangkat lunak (Microsoft Security Intelligence Report).
Cara Mengatasi Kerentanan Perangkat Lunak
Mengatasi kerentanan perangkat lunak adalah tugas yang krusial dalam memitigasi risiko serangan siber. Berikut beberapa langkah yang dapat diambil:
1. Pembaruan Perangkat Lunak
Melakukan pembaruan perangkat lunak secara teratur adalah salah satu cara terbaik untuk mengatasi kerentanan. Pembaruan sering kali mengandung perbaikan keamanan yang memperbaiki kerentanan yang telah teridentifikasi.
2. Pemindaian Keamanan
Secara rutin memindai perangkat lunak dan jaringan Anda untuk kerentanan potensial adalah langkah penting dalam menjaga keamanan siber. Ini dapat membantu Anda mengidentifikasi dan mengatasi kerentanan sebelum penyerang dapat memanfaatkannya.
3. Implementasi Keamanan Multi-Faktor
Menerapkan autentikasi multi-faktor (MFA) dapat membantu melindungi akun dan sistem Anda bahkan jika ada kerentanan yang berhasil dieksploitasi. MFA memerlukan lebih dari satu metode identifikasi, seperti kata sandi dan kode otentikasi, untuk mengakses akun.
Kesimpulan
Keamanan siber dan kerentanan perangkat lunak adalah topik yang sangat penting dalam dunia digital saat ini. Dengan pemahaman tentang konsep ini dan langkah-langkah yang dapat diambil untuk mengatasi kerentanan perangkat lunak, Anda dapat memitigasi risiko serangan siber dan melindungi data Anda dengan lebih baik.
Ingatlah bahwa serangan siber terus berkembang, dan menjaga perangkat lunak Anda tetap diperbarui adalah salah satu langkah terbaik untuk menghindari kerentanan perangkat lunak yang dapat dimanfaatkan oleh penyerang.